Introduction to the Master of Science in Sustainable Energy

The Master of Science in Sustainable Energy is a postgraduate program designed to equip students with the knowledge and skills necessary to tackle the complex challenges of sustainable energy. This program aims to provide a comprehensive understanding of sustainable energy systems, including their technical, economic, and environmental aspects.


Program Description

The Master of Science in Sustainable Energy program is tailored to meet the growing demand for professionals with expertise in sustainable energy. The program covers a wide range of topics, including energy efficiency, renewable energy technologies, energy policy, and sustainability.


Program Objectives

  • To provide students with a deep understanding of sustainable energy principles and practices
  • To equip students with the skills to design, develop, and implement sustainable energy solutions
  • To foster critical thinking and problem-solving abilities in the context of sustainable energy

Admission Criteria

Admission to the Master of Science in Sustainable Energy program is based on a combination of academic merit, professional experience, and language proficiency. Applicants are required to hold a bachelor's degree in a relevant field, such as engineering, environmental science, or economics.


Admission Requirements

  • A bachelor's degree from a recognized institution
  • A minimum GPA or equivalent
  • English language proficiency
  • Relevant work experience (optional)

Research Areas

The Master of Science in Sustainable Energy program offers a range of research areas, including:


  • Renewable energy technologies
  • Energy efficiency and conservation
  • Sustainable energy policy and economics
  • Environmental impact assessment of energy systems

Research Opportunities

  • Students have the opportunity to work with renowned faculty members on cutting-edge research projects
  • Collaborations with industry partners and government agencies provide students with hands-on experience and networking opportunities

Program Structure

The Master of Science in Sustainable Energy program is typically completed within two years of full-time study. The program consists of coursework, research projects, and a thesis.


Curriculum

  • Core courses: sustainable energy principles, energy systems, and sustainability
  • Elective courses: renewable energy technologies, energy policy, and environmental impact assessment
  • Research projects and thesis
